Disallowance being pre-operative expenses on the reason that date on which VAT license was obtained was the date of commencement of business and not the date of incorporation - When the first steps are taken by the assessee, business is said to be set up, based on which commencement of purchase and sales activities will start. In view of these facts, we are of the opinion that the business is said to be commenced from the date of placing purchase order i.e., on 6.10.2010 and all expenditure incurred from this date i.e., 6.10.2010 to be considered as business expenditure and to be allowed accordingly. - AT
